2026 Kentucky Derby: Key Contenders and Insights

4/24/2026, 2:41:55 AM

Overview of the Event

The 2026 Kentucky Derby, scheduled for May 2 at Churchill Downs, is shaping up to be a highly competitive race featuring a mix of seasoned contenders and promising newcomers. Among the notable entries are Commandment, Further Ado, and Renegade, who have emerged as frontrunners based on their performances in the lead-up to the Derby.

Key Contenders

Commandment

Trained by Brad Cox, Commandment is currently one of the favorites with odds at 7-1. He has accumulated 150 points on the Road to the Kentucky Derby, showcasing a strong performance in the Florida Derby where he narrowly edged out The Puma. Despite his recent success, some experts, including Jody Demling, express skepticism about his ability to secure a win, citing Cox's recent struggles with Derby favorites.

Further Ado

Further Ado, also trained by Brad Cox, has garnered attention after a commanding victory in the Blue Grass Stakes, winning by 11 lengths. With odds at 17-1, he is seen as a strong contender, especially given his consistent performance and pedigree, being sired by Gun Runner. Experts like Ed DeRosa and Travis Stone have highlighted Further Ado's potential, comparing him to past Derby winners due to his impressive form.

Renegade

Renegade, the current favorite at 4-1, has shown remarkable improvement, winning both of his starts as a 3-year-old, including the prestigious Arkansas Derby. Trained by Todd Pletcher, Renegade's success has led to high expectations, although some analysts caution about his racing style and the challenges posed by the crowded field at the Derby.

International Contenders

Japan's Wonder Dean is another intriguing entry, aiming to break Japan's 0-for-21 record in the Derby. After winning the UAE Derby, he arrives with a strong pedigree and is priced at 40-1. His trainer, Daisuke Takayanagi, is optimistic about his chances, although concerns about his competition level in Japan linger.

Post Position Draw and Its Impact

The post position draw, scheduled for April 25, will play a crucial role in determining the race dynamics. Historically, horses drawn from positions 5-15 have had better success rates, while inside positions have struggled significantly in recent years. This year’s draw will be particularly important given the anticipated large field of 20 horses.
